Mural painted last week in Prince Edward County. Inside the Old Boys Memorial Entrance building, the mural depicts the site’s storied history as training grounds for Canadian soldiers during WW1, WW2 and the Picton Fairgrounds.
Mural at Complexe Desjardins celebrating their 50th anniversary. A chronological journey back to its construction in 1976. The artwork pays tribute to an iconic hub of Montreal community, culture, commerce and architecture. Spanning over 225 feet.
